California Highway Patrol, California
End of Watch Wednesday, August 14, 1985
Add to My HeroesRaymond E. Miller
Officer Raymond Miller succumbed to injuries sustained two weeks earlier when he was pinned between his patrol car and another vehicle on I-5 south of Bakersfield.
He was checking on an illegally parked car when a truck driver fell asleep and collided with the back of his patrol car.
The truck driver was issued a citation in connection with the incident.
Officer Miller was a United States Maine Corps veteran and had served with the California Highway Patrol for 16 years. He was survived by his wife and two children.
